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
308574 947578 281 851
65205873288 36632359392
65205873288 36632359392
99754063 7748 0158972 6370 1405
All about undefined
Interested in learning more?
65205873288 36632359392
99754063 7748 0158972 6370 1405
See more
635879698 1968419717 72799102398
7537539 9028983 9197 179461
See more
26539732774 6495742
3130010335 4678 2286135
See more